Longoria's Illustrious Career with the Tampa Bay Rays
Evan Longoria's journey with the Tampa Bay Rays is a story of remarkable talent, unwavering perseverance, and undeniable impact. Drafted third overall in the 2006 MLB draft, Longoria quickly ascended through the minor leagues, showcasing the power and defensive prowess that would define his career. His "Longoria Rays career" began in earnest in 2008, instantly establishing him as a cornerstone of the team. He quickly became a fan favorite, embodying the spirit of a "Tampa Bay Rays legend".
Longoria's contributions to the Rays' success were immeasurable. As a stellar third baseman, his consistent performance solidified the Rays’ infield and propelled the team to multiple playoff appearances, including their unforgettable 2008 AL Championship Series run. He was a consistent All-Star, showcasing his remarkable skills at the plate and in the field. His performance wasn't just about statistics; it was about clutch hits, diving plays, and an unwavering determination that inspired his teammates and captivated fans. He was truly a playoff hero for the Rays.
